Cisco has long provided VPN
solutions for site-to-site connectivity. With the
recent acquisition of Altiga Networks, makers of
remote-access VPN platforms, Cisco now offers end-to-end
VPN solutions to suit both large and small
organizations. Altiga's products are now available as
the Cisco VPN concentrator series.
The Cisco VPN 3000 Concentrator
Series includes a standards-based, easy-to-use VPN
client and scalable VPN tunnel termination devices. The
management system enables corporations to easily
install, configure and monitor their remote access VPNs.
Incorporating the most-advanced, high-availability
capabilities with a unique purpose-built, remote-access
architecture, the Cisco VPN 3000 Concentrator allows
corporations to build high-performance, scalable, and
robust VPN infrastructures to support their
mission-critical, remote-access applications. Unique to
the industry, it is the only scalable platform to offer
components that are field-swappable and can be upgraded
by the customer. These components, called Scalable
Encryption Processing (SEP) modules, enable users to
easily add capacity and throughput. The Cisco VPN 3000
Concentrator supports the widest range of VPN client
software implementations, including the Cisco VPN 3000
Client, the Microsoft Windows 2000 L2TP/IPsec Client and
the Microsoft PPTP for Windows 95, Windows 98, and
Windows NT.
The Cisco VPN 3000 Concentrator is
available in five different models to support any
business:
Cisco VPN 3005 Concentrator
The 3005
is a VPN platform designed for small- to medium-sized
organizations with bandwidth requirements up to
full-duplex T1/E1 (4Mbps maximum performance) and up to
100 simultaneous sessions. Encryption processing is
performed in software. The 3005 does not have built-in
upgrade capability.
Cisco VPN 3015 Concentrator
The 3015
is a VPN platform designed for small- to medium-sized
organizations with bandwidth requirements up to full-x
T1/E1 (4Mbps maximum performance) and up to 100
simultaneous sessions. Like the 3005, encryption
processing is performed in software, but the 3015 is
also field-upgradeable to models 3030 ,3060, and 3080.
Cisco VPN 3030 Concentrator
The 3030
is a VPN platform designed for medium- to large-sized
organizations with bandwidth requirements from full
T1/E1 through fractional T3 (50 Mbps maximum
performance) and up to 1500 simultaneous sessions.
Specialized SEP modules perform hardware-based
acceleration. The 3030 is field-upgradeable to the 3060.
Redundant and non-redundant configurations are
available.
Cisco VPN 3060 Concentrator
The 3060
is a VPN platform designed for large organizations
demanding the highest level of performance and
reliability, with high-bandwidth requirements from
fractional T3 through full T3/E3 or greater (100 Mbps
maximum performance) and up to 5000 simultaneous
sessions. Specialized SEP modules perform hardware-based
acceleration. Redundant and non-redundant configurations
are available.
Cisco VPN 3080 Concentrator
The 3080
is optimized to support large enterprise organizations
that demand the highest level of performance combined
with support for up to 10,000 simultaneous remote access
sessions. Specialized SEP modules perform hardware-based
acceleration. The VPN 3080 is available in a fully
redundant configuration only.
Cisco VPN 3000 Client
Simple
to deploy and operate, the Cisco VPN 3000 Client is used
to establish secure, end-to-end encrypted tunnels to the
Cisco VPN 3000 Concentrator. This thin design, IPsec-compliant
implementation is provided with the Cisco VPN 3000
Concentrator and is licensed for an unlimited number of
users. The client can be pre-configured for mass
deployments and initial logins require very little user
intervention. VPN access policies are created and stored
centrally in the Cisco VPN 3000 Concentrator and pushed
to the client when a connection is established.
Cisco VPN
3000 Monitor
The
Cisco VPN 3000 Monitor is a software application for
centralized monitoring, alert, and data collection on
one or more Cisco VPN 3000 Concentrators. The Java-based
utility is compatible with Windows 95, Windows 98, and
Windows NT. Simple Network Management Protocol (SNMP)
polling is used to collect statistics from each device.
The Enterprise View displays high-level status for each
device in the network. The administrator may also obtain
granular data on each device. In addition, the Cisco VPN
3000 Monitor stores polled data, traps, and logs for
historical analysis, capacity planning, and
troubleshooting. Standard tables and graphs are
provided.
